
| Regimental number | 12/1964 |
| Date of birth | |
| Place of birth | New Plymouth |
| Religion | Wesleyan |
| Occupation | Plasterer |
| Address | c/o Mrs Payne, Hobson Street, Hastings |
| Marital status | Married |
| Age at embarkation | 30.8 |
| Height | 5' 9.25" |
| Weight | 171 lbs |
| Next of kin | Wife, Mrs Rose Gregory, 17 Byron Street, Sydenham, Christchurch |
| Previous military service | Nil |
| Enlistment date | |
| Place of enlistment | Trentham |
| Rank on embarkation | Private |
| Enlistment status | Volunteer |
| Unit name | New Zealand Expeditionary Force, 4th Reinforcements, Auckland Infantry Battalion |
| Embarkation details | Unit embarked from Wellington on board HMNZT 21 Willochra on |
| Final rank | Private |
| Final unit | Auckland Infantry Regiment |
| Fate | Killed in Action |
| Age at death from cemetery records | 30 |
| Place of burial | No known grave |
| Commemoration details | Chunuk Bair (New Zealand) Memorial (Panel No 10), Gallipoli, Turkey |
| Miscellaneous information from cemetery records | Husband of Rose M. Forbes (formerly Gregory), Sydenham, Christchurch |
| Other details |
War service: Egypt, Gallipoli Joined unit at Gallipoli, 8 June 1915. Reported missing, 8 August 1915. Board of Enquiry, held at Moascar Camp, Ismailia, 16 January 1916, concluded: 'Now reported believed dead'. War service: 210 days (of which 114 days were abroad) Medals: 1914-15 Star, British War Medal, Victory Medal |
